The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) has awarded Accenture Federal Services a spot on a potential five-year, $49 million indefinite/delivery-indefinite/quantity contract to provide intelligent automation and artificial intelligence (IAAI) services for HHS’ Program Support Center (PSC), Accenture Federal Services announced on Wednesday.

Shamlan Siddiqi, chief technology officer of NTT DATA’s public sector business, has said the federal government should advance information technology modernization in order to meet the needs and expectations of citizens. He wrote in a white paper that IT modernization is now a necessity and government agencies should plan for that modernization effort by focusing on six areas: data and intelligence; customer experience; internet of things; intelligent automation; cybersecurity; and IT optimization.

Andrew Zeswitz, former chief technology officer at REI Systems, has assumed the same post at PBG Consulting, an 8(a) women-owned, mission-focused digital consultancy. He will be responsible for helping PBG expand its technology delivery organization and its range of capabilities in support of federal civilian customers, the McLean, Virginia-based consultant said.

CGI Federal has secured a potential five-year, $72 million award to modernize a healthcare system for the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services. Under the single award, firm-fixed price contract, CGI will work to transform plan enrollment and compliance processes for hundreds of private health and drug plans supported by the agency’s Health Plan Management System, the Fairfax, Virginia-based company said Tuesday.

The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ency has added NetImpact Strategies’ suite of DX360 software-as-a-service offerings to its Approved Products List as part of the Continuous Diagnostics and Mitigation program. NetImpact said Thursday its DX360 SaaS tools are categorized into three product lines: Cybersecurity and Enterprise Risk Management, Digital Dexterity and Case Manager.

George Franz leads Accenture Federal Services’ Department of Defense cyber portfolio as a managing director, a role in which he focuses on cyber threats, risk mitigation opportunities and strategies for improving cyber defenses. In a recent interview with ExecutiveBiz, Franz shared his insights on the evolving cybersecurity landscape, the potential of the Joint Cyber Warfighting Architecture to revolutionize DOD warfighting capabilities and Accenture Federal Services’ role in providing the DOD with the technology necessary to achieve its mission.
